Yes it is just the regulator cover with the screw that is different, how old is the diaphragm?
They can tear with age and leak fuel into the sump via the vacuum hose, or leak through the hose onto engine and result in fire.
I recommend replacing the diaphragm as well, cheap insurance.

Thanks for the reply. I started my car this morning and raw gas was coming out of the exhaust. Pulled the vacuum line to regulator and there was gas there so I'm in the process of removing plenum now to get to the regulator.

You will need a Torx T-10 security bit to get the FPR cover off. I guess they didn't want people messing with it...
